Adoption details
Adopting with Kittie Kat Rescue Inc.
Bringing a new pet into your home is a long-term commitment—both emotionally and financially. Cats can live 15 to 20 years, so it's essential that all family members are prepared to provide love, shelter, and a safe environment for their lifetime. This includes premium nutrition, regular veterinary care, and ensuring they are kept indoors only or have access to a secure, cat-proof outdoor enclosure.
Our Adoption Process:
-Initial Contact & Questionnaire. We’ll start by sending you our adoption questionnaire via email or text message. This helps us understand your home environment and what you're looking for in a feline companion.
-Video Tour. We will require a video tour of your home, focusing on safety features such as secure screens on windows, doors and balconies. Plus, we’d love to see where your new kitty will be set up in their new home!
-Meet & Greet with the Foster Carer. Once your application is complete and approved, we’ll arrange a time for you to meet the cat with their foster carer.
-Adoption & Bringing Your Cat Home. In some cases, if your application is approved and the cat has completed all their vet work, they can go home with you straight after the meet and greet (an adoption fee is payable). Adoption paperwork will follow.
-Settling-In Period & Adoption Finalisation. Every adoption includes a two-week settling-in period from the time of adoption. If, for any reason, your new cat isn’t the right fit for your home, you can return them within this period for a 50% refund of the adoption fee.
-All of our cats come microchipped, desexed, with one or more vaccinations, and will be lifetime registered. Depending on their age, kittens may need their second (and potentially third) vaccination undertaken by the adopter after adoption. The transfer of ownership is completed as soon as possible.
Adoption fees:
-Kittens: $350
-Cats 1 - 3 Years: $275
-Cats 3 Years+: $200
All adoptions will also carry a lifetime registration/admin fee of $50 on top of the above adoption price.
